Abstract

The invention requests to protect a merchant returned customer prediction method based on big data. The method comprises the following steps: 101, carrying out preprocessing operation on historical behavior data of a consumer; 102, training set data and verification set data are divided according to historical behaviors; 103, performing feature engineering operation on the historical behavior dataof the consumer; 104, performing feature selection on the sample set with the constructed features; 105, establishing a plurality of machine learning models, and carrying out model fusion operation;106, predicting whether the new buyer buys the commodity again in the same merchant in six months in the future according to the historical behavior data of the consumer through the established model.According to the invention, pretreatment and analysis are carried out to extract features, features are selected, a plurality of machine learning models are established, and whether a new buyer purchases commodities in the same merchant again in six months in the future is predicted according to consumption behavior data of the consumer in half a year before Double Eleven, thereby providing services for the merchant to accurately locate potential loyalty customers, reduce the promotion cost and improve the investment return.

technical field [0001] The present invention relates to the field of machine learning and big data processing, especially feature construction, model design, model fusion scheme and the like. Background technique [0002] With the rapid development of the global economy, the era of economic information is advancing steadily. As a new way of business circulation and communication with people, e-commerce has emerged in the era of information economy. The rapid development of e-commerce has also brought huge competitive pressure to various merchants, so merchants sometimes conduct big promotions on certain dates and time points, and attract a large number of new buyers in this way. But unfortunately, many buyers who are attracted by promotional activities are "deal hunters" who only spend one-time consumption.
